Minter Ellison has brought on Stephen Loosley, a former NSW senator and national president of the Australian Labour Party, as a special counsel.

Loosley is also a former partner of PricewaterhouseCoopers Legal, Dunhill Madden Butler, and most recently he worked at investment and advisory firm Babcock & Brown. He is also currently the chairman of the Committee for Sydney and of the Strategic Policy Institute in Canberra, and he serves on numerous boards.

In his new role, Loosley will help the firm's leadership team on business development initiatives targeting both the public and private sectors.
